Key Specifications

  • Model: APC Smart-UPS 5000VA (SUA5000RMI5U)
  • Power Capacity: 5000VA / 4000W
  • Topology: Line Interactive
  • Output Voltage: 230V (configurable for 220 or 240V)
  • Output Connections: 8x IEC 320 C13, 2x IEC 320 C19, 4x IEC Jumpers (all battery-backed)
  • Input Voltage: 230V
  • Input Connection: Hard wire 3-wire (L, N, E) or IEC-320 C20
  • Input Voltage Range: 160-286V (main operations); adjustable to 151-302V
  • Input Frequency: 50/60 Hz ± 3 Hz (auto-sensing)
  • Waveform Type: Pure sine wave
  • Transfer Time: 2ms typical
  • Battery Type: Maintenance-free sealed lead-acid battery (leakproof)
  • Typical Recharge Time: 3 hours
  • Battery Runtime: ~26.7 minutes at half load (2000W); ~9.4 minutes at full load (4000W)
  • Replacement Battery: RBC55
  • Battery Life: 3-5 years
  • Dimensions: 22.2 x 48.3 x 66.0 cm (H x W x D, 5U rack height)
  • Weight: 97.73 kg (215 lbs)
  • Interfaces: DB-9 RS-232, USB, SmartSlot (includes Web/SNMP management card)
  • Surge Energy Rating: 365 Joules
  • Filtering: 0.3% IEEE surge let-through, zero clamping response time, meets UL 1449
  • Certifications: CE, KEMA, complies with IEC standards
  • Warranty: 2-year repair or replacement warranty
  • Included Accessories: PowerChute Business Edition software CD, RS-232 cable, USB cable, rack mounting support rails, user manual, Web/SNMP management card

Design and Build

The SUA5000RMI5U is a 5U rackmount/tower convertible UPS, offering flexibility for data center racks or standalone tower setups. Measuring 22.2 x 48.3 x 66.0 cm and weighing 97.73 kg, it’s a substantial unit due to its large lead-acid battery, requiring careful placement in a well-ventilated area to prevent overheating. The front panel features an intuitive LCD interface and navigation keys for monitoring power status, battery health, and load levels.

The UPS includes 14 output connections (8x IEC C13, 2x IEC C19, 4x IEC Jumpers), accommodating a wide range of devices, from blade servers to networking gear. Its hot-swappable battery design allows maintenance without powering down connected equipment, and the SmartSlot supports optional accessories like network management cards for remote monitoring. The robust build and rack mounting hardware ensure secure installation in professional environments.

Performance

The SUA5000RMI5U delivers reliable power protection through its line-interactive topology, featuring:

  • Automatic Voltage Regulation (AVR): Boosts low input voltages by up to 30% and trims high voltages by up to 12% without battery use, ensuring stable power during fluctuations.
  • Pure Sine Wave Output: Provides clean power with less than 5% voltage distortion, ideal for sensitive equipment using active power factor corrected (PFC) power supplies.
  • Fast Transfer Time: Switches to battery in 2ms, ensuring seamless operation during outages.
  • Runtime: Offers ~26.7 minutes at half load (2000W) and ~9.4 minutes at full load (4000W), sufficient for safe shutdowns or bridging short outages. External battery packs can extend runtime for critical applications.
  • Efficiency: Achieves up to 95% efficiency at full load and includes a green operating mode (Energy Star certified) to reduce energy costs.

The UPS provides network-grade power conditioning, protecting against surges (365 Joules), spikes, lightning, and EMI/RFI noise, minimizing data errors and equipment wear. Its surge suppression meets UL 1449 standards with zero clamping response time. In user tests, the SUA5000RMI5U reliably powered server racks and networking equipment during outages, with PowerChute software enabling automated shutdowns to prevent data loss.

Features

The SUA5000RMI5U is packed with advanced features for reliability and manageability:

  • PowerChute Business Edition Software: Enables monitoring, control, and safe system shutdowns via USB or RS-232, ideal for IT administrators managing servers or workstations.
  • Intelligent Battery Management: Maximizes battery life (3-5 years) through temperature-compensated charging, with automatic self-tests and early failure notifications.
  • Hot-Swappable Batteries: Allows battery replacement (RBC55) without interrupting connected devices, reducing downtime.
  • Surge Protection and Noise Filtering: Shields equipment from power disturbances, meeting stringent IEEE standards.
  • Web/SNMP Management Card: Included for network manageability via serial, USB, or optional Ethernet, enabling remote monitoring and control.
  • Predictive Failure Notification: Provides early warnings for proactive component replacement.
  • Resettable Circuit Breakers: Facilitates quick recovery from overloads without replacing fuses.
  • LCD Interface: Offers over 15 programmable settings, including switched outlet group control, for application-specific customization.

These features make the SUA5000RMI5U ideal for data centers, server rooms, point-of-sale systems, and network hubs requiring uninterrupted power.

Compatibility

The SUA5000RMI5U supports 230V power systems with a hard wire 3-wire input or IEC-320 C20 connector, compatible with UK and European outlets. Its 14 output sockets support servers, routers, switches, and other critical devices. The UPS integrates with Windows, Linux, and Unix systems via PowerChute software, and its USB, RS-232, and Web/SNMP interfaces ensure connectivity with modern and legacy systems. The SmartSlot enables network integration for remote management, making it suitable for enterprise environments.

What is the APC 5000VA Smart Rackmount UPS (SUA5000RMI5U)?

The APC SUA5000RMI5U is a line-interactive UPS with a 5000VA (Volt-Amps) or 4000-watt capacity, designed for 230V power environments common in regions like Europe, Africa, and Asia. Part of the renowned Smart-UPS family, it combines intelligent power management with a versatile rackmount/tower convertible design, occupying 5U of rack space. This UPS is engineered to deliver network-grade power protection, making it a trusted choice for over 25 million Smart-UPS units sold globally.

Its line-interactive topology ensures efficient voltage regulation, while its rackmount form factor caters to data centers and server rooms, though it can also stand as a tower for smaller setups. With a focus on scalability and reliability, the SUA5000RMI5U is a premium option for demanding applications.


Key Features of the SUA5000RMI5U

1. High Power Capacity

  • 5000VA / 4000W Output: Supports power-hungry devices like servers, storage systems, and networking hardware.
  • Multiple Outlets: Features 8 IEC C13 outlets, 2 IEC C19 outlets, and 4 IEC jumpers, all with battery backup, offering ample connectivity options.

2. Line-Interactive Technology

  • Equipped with Automatic Voltage Regulation (AVR), it corrects voltage fluctuations (160-286V) without switching to battery power, improving efficiency and preserving battery life.

3. Pure Sine Wave Output

  • Provides clean power with less than 5% total harmonic distortion, ensuring compatibility with sensitive electronics and active PFC power supplies.

4. Advanced Battery Management

  • Uses a sealed lead-acid battery (RBC55 replacement), hot-swappable for zero-downtime replacement. Runtime averages 9-10 minutes at full load (4000W) and 26-27 minutes at half load (2000W).
  • Intelligent, temperature-compensated charging extends battery life (typically 3-5 years).

5. Connectivity and Monitoring

  • USB, Serial, and SmartSlot: Comes with a Web/SNMP management card for remote monitoring, plus USB and RS-232 ports for local management via APC’s PowerChute software.
  • Emergency Power Off (EPO): Allows remote shutdown in emergencies.

6. User-Friendly Interface

  • LED Indicators: Display load, battery status, and operational modes.
  • Audible Alarms: Alert users to power events or low battery conditions.

7. Surge Protection and Noise Filtering

  • Offers a 480-joule surge energy rating and full-time multi-pole noise filtering, safeguarding equipment from electrical disturbances.

8. Rackmount/Tower Convertible

  • Ships with rackmount hardware and support rails, but can be configured as a standalone tower, adapting to various environments.
